    Front doors metal scuff plates-exceed

    Hi,
    Does anyone know how to remove the metal scuff plates that are on the surface where the door bottom closes. They have Pajero written on them and I want to remove and place on a new Pajero that doesn't have them? Seems to have two black caps that look like they should be able to be removed but I can't.

            Theyre not on the plastic trim as they are ds taped to the body work

            Remove very carefully as they bend easy and the tape is solid!!......ive removed mine...hated them as the rubber around the edge fell away too easy and made them look shite and they just looked tacky, much different than i was described at the dealers

            I put the stock ones back on and am much happier now

              I fitted the alloy ones to the front, I left the double sided tape off and use only the black clips, and yes on the driver's side the thin rubber strip is falling off a and looks like crap, can't see them lasting. To get them off with tape you would have to destroy them and replace with std ones

                I used a combination of long stanley blades and fishing line and got them off without damage...but it took forever and i now wish i just tore them off lol
